William M Bogdan, age 81, passed away peacefully on the morning of January 27, 2025. He was born in Akron, Ohio on September 7, 1943. Bill graduated from Garfield High School in 1961. He was one of the top 10 little league baseball players in Akron. Bill received his bachelor's degree in education in 1967 at the University of Akron. He would have completed his masters in Geology but would have to complete fieldwork in Nevada for 6 months. Instead, he continued his position as computer programmer for B.F Goodrich / Uniroyal Tires / Michelin in advances in computer software technologies for over 30 years. Bill married Karen S. Schieller in July 1968. He was a devoted family man. He was active with his children's activities, Kristina Julius (Bruce) and Keith D. Bogdan, coaching, taking to sporting activities / events, traveling and spending time with his family. After retirement, he contracted at various business to update and initiate their software programs in Canada and U.S.
   
  
During retirement, Bill spent time sharing his observations, experiences and past with others via email. He had several editorials published in the Akron Beacon Journal about his views of the world. Bill created several books: children's book with his illustrations and writings; collections of his email letters, and his art. He entered several art competitions in Akron and Canton. His main method was Woodcuts. His art reflected his life and inspirations. He was a devoted Cleveland sports fan. He never missed a Cavaliers, Guardians/Indians or Browns game on television.
